Как найти твиты, содержащие URL? - PullRequest
18 голосов
/ 27 августа 2010

Есть ли возможность поиска твитов, которые ссылаются на определенный URL или, что еще лучше, домен?

Уже есть служба, которая делает это, но я не могу понять, как сделать это самостоятельно через твиттер-API ...

http://backtweets.com/api

Кажется довольно невозможным просто собрать все твиты, содержащие URL-адрес, развернуть URL-адрес, сохранить их все и только потом искать определенные URL-адреса.

Ответы [ 2 ]

10 голосов
/ 27 августа 2010

Новое решение:

Вы можете использовать метод API get-tweet-search из API Twitters. Чтобы найти твиты, содержащие URL, вы должны передать параметр q="url:stackoverflow.com". К сожалению, для выполнения этого вызова у вас должен быть токен доступа.

Более подробную информацию о том, как использовать операторы поиска Twitters, можно найти по адресу https://developer.twitter.com/en/docs/tweets/search/guides/standard-operators.


Этому ответу скоро 8 лет. С тех пор Twitter изменил свой API.

Старый ответ:

Надеюсь, это поможет.

http://search.twitter.com/search.atom?q=<query>
You can use .atom (xml) and .json. Just remeber to url-encode the string.

Example:
http://search.twitter.com/search.json?q=stackoverflow.com

Прочитайте Документацию здесь

1 голос
/ 13 января 2014

Почему вы не используете ключевое слово site:"google.com".Он возвращает твиты, в которых есть хотя бы один URL-адрес ссылки на домен google.com с другим ограничением.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...